Borno, Bank of Industry collaborate to garner N1bn for SMEs in state

By Dauda R. Pam, Maiduguri
The Borno State Government and the Bank of Industry, (BoI) has concluded plans to on equal contributions, generate N1billion, to enhance small and medium entrepreneurs in seven local government areas of the state.
This was  disclosed by the Executive Director, Small and Medium Enterprises of BOI, Mr Shekarau Dauda Umar, following the outcome of a meeting held Maiduguri between Governor Babagana Zulum and a delegation of the  bank.
According to the meeting, both parties will contribute N500million to be disbursed in form of loans to eligible entrepreneurs and that, the pilot scheme of the disbursement, will attract business owners from Monday Market, Gamboru Market, Tashan Bama, Tashan Baga, Budum, firewood and vegetable sellers all in Maiduguri.
He said that,the second phase of the programme will focus on entrepreneurs in Biu,Ngala, Monguno, Dikwa, Bama and Gwoza.
It could be recalled,the Governor, Prof. Zulum, had earlier on December 5, 2019 visited the Bank’s headquarters in Abuja, where he made a special case for citizens of Borno State given the challenges of insurgency which has made thousands of people lose their means of livelihood.
